What is Sei?

Sei is a high-performance blockchain designed specifically for decentralized finance (DeFi) applications. It offers fast transaction speeds, scalability, and a secure environment, making it an ideal platform for deploying DeFi applications and services.

What is the Sei API?

The Sei API facilitates interaction with the Sei network through a collection of JSON-RPC methods. It provides developers with tools to interact with the blockchain, enabling functionalities such as transactions, smart contract deployment, and data retrieval.

Is Sei EVM compatible?

Yes, Sei is fully compatible with the Ethereum Virtual Machine (EVM). This compatibility allows Ethereum developers to port their projects to Sei with minimal changes, benefiting from the chain's high performance and low transaction fees.

What API does Sei use?

Sei uses the JSON-RPC API standard for blockchain interactions. This is the same standard used by Ethereum.

What is a Sei API key?

When accessing the Sei network via a node provider like Alchemy, developers use an API key to send transactions and retrieve data from the network.

Which libraries support Sei?

Given Sei's EVM compatibility, popular Ethereum libraries like ethers.js and web3.js are fully compatible with Sei. This allows for seamless development and integration for those familiar with Ethereum's development ecosystem.

What programming languages work with Sei?

Similar to Ethereum, Sei supports a range of programming languages for blockchain interaction and smart contract development, including Solidity for smart contracts, as well as JavaScript and TypeScript for dApp development and off-chain interactions.

What does Sei use for gas?

Sei uses SEI, its native cryptocurrency, for transaction fees, gas, and other network activities.
